Uzbek president to allow US non-military transport
Uzbek President Islam Karimov (pictured) has agreed to allow US non-military supplies to Afghanistan to transit through his country. The announcement comes after nearby Kyrgyzstan said it would close its US military base.
AFP - Uzbekistan has agreed to allow the United States to transport non-military supplies through its territory to neighbouring Afghanistan, President Islam Karimov said Wednesday.
"Uzbekistan has agreed to allow non-military, I underline, non-military cargo to be transited through Uzbek territory to Afghanistan, in accordance with exisiting Uzbek legislation," Karimov told reporters.
The United States has been seeking new transit routes to supply coalition forces in increasingly unstable Afghanistan since nearby Kyrgyzstan announced the closure of a key US airbase on its territory earlier this month.
